5.2.1
General notes
The Quick Setup menu (see Page 61) is adequate for commissioning with the neces-
sary standard settings. Complex measurement tasks on the other hand necessitate
additional functions that you can configure as necessary and customize to suit your
process condition. The function matrix, therefore, comprises a multiplicity of additional
functions which, for the sake of clarity, are arranged in a number of function groups.
Comply with the following instructions when configuring functions:
x You select functions as described on Page 42.
x You can switch off certain functions (OFF). If you do so, related functions in other func-
tion groups will no longer be displayed.
x Certain functions prompt you to confirm your data entries. Press OS to select "SURE
[ YES ]" and press F again to confirm. This saves your setting or starts a function, as
applicable.
x Return to the HOME position is automatic if no key is pressed for 5 minutes.
Note!
x The transmitter continues to measure while data entry is in progress, i.e. the current
measured values are output via the signal outputs in the normal way.
x If the power supply fails all preset and parameterised values remain safely stored in
the EEPROM.

5.2.2
Enabling the programming mode
The function matrix can be disabled. Disabling the function matrix rules out the possi-
bility of inadvertent changes to device functions, numerical values or factory settings. A
numerical code (factory setting = 90) has to be entered before settings can be
changed.
If you use a code number of your choice, you exclude the possibility of unauthorized
persons accessing data ( o see the "Description of Device Functions" manual).
Comply with the following instructions when entering codes:
x If programming is disabled and the OS keys are pressed in any function, a prompt
for the code automatically appears on the display.
x If "0" is entered as the customer's code, programming is always enabled.
x The E+H service organisation can be of assistance if you mislay your personal code.
Caution!
Changing certain parameters such as all sensor characteristics, for example, influences
numerous functions of the entire measuring device, particularly measuring accuracy.
There is no need to change these parameters under normal circumstances and conse-
quently, they are protected by a special code known only to the E+H service organisa-
tion. Please contact Endress+Hauser if you have any questions.
5.2.3
Disabling the programming mode
Programming mode is disabled if you do not press an operating element within 60 sec-
onds after you return to the HOME position.
You can also disable programming in the "ACCESS CODE" function by entering any
number (other than the customer's code).
